Great casual spot for pizza, Italian food and general lunch & dinner fare. We stopped by after a trip to Bluebird Farms Alpaca and the owners recommended Gladstone Market. Glad we did, the service was great, the food was even better and the atmosphere out back was relaxing and comfortable. Apparently Gladstone Tavern next door is just as good but with a bigger menu and not as casual as Market. The starter bread with oil and garlic was out of this world, fresh, warm, little crisp on the top w/ soft fluffy in the middle. The back patio area overlooks a nice little creek and just creates a laid back, relaxing atmosphere that would be enjoyable on a date or as a family (all the above were present on a Saturday, 6pm). Split into two tables of 6 and the waitress (Emily I believe) did a great job of taking care of both tables plus the others she had. Prob room for approx 20-25 total on back patio and they have a small indoor dining area with multiple 2, 4 & 6 top tables. Apps, meatballs (huge, great flavor), fried calamari (good, nothing earth shattering) and garlic knots and moz sticks for kids (must have been good, lasted 2 mins). For the pizza, they were happy to make a gluten free from one of the kids and the rest of us shared large plain, large peperoni, large 1/2 plain, 1/2 onion (all 3 thin crust) and a large Sicilian peperoni & mushroom. All the pizzas were fantastic. The crust was crispy on all of them, including the thick Sicilian pie. Sauce was unique and delicious. We're usually thin crust pizza lovers but the star of the show was the Sicilian, thick crust yet light and fluffy but crisp bottom. One of the best Sicilians we've had. All in all a great dining experience, highly recommended! Cute little town, great service, great food, outstanding scenery.
